Transaction 8455a305afbaeaeb74e5fe54df4ba2aae7c64171887903a4f29d6a89f7c41926
1 Input
1 Output
-
8455a305afbaeaeb74e5fe54df4ba2aae7c64171887903a4f29d6a89f7c41926:0
- value
- 68551647
- script pubkey
- OP_0 OP_PUSHBYTES_20 e102816338dc6ac4bec2e1bbf90d9cdbf3fd0390
- address
- bc1quypgzcecm34vf0kzuxaljrvum0el6qus60zgtg